Recognizing Ohio’s Turnip the Beet awardees

2/27/2023

The United States Department of Agriculture (USDA) Turnip the Beet Award showcases national schools and community organizations that go above and beyond summer food service program requirements. Awards are granted for bronze, silver or gold level. Based on program year 2022 activities, three Ohio summer meal sponsors received this award. Congratulations to:

  • The Lodi Family Center, gold award recipient;
  • Cincinnati Public Schools, silver award recipient; and
  • The Greater Cleveland Food Banks, bronze award recipients.

Honored awardees serve age-appropriate foods, use menus featuring a variety of quality vegetables, fruits and whole grains and locally sourced foods, and engage in food- and nutrition-related activities. 

In addition to hunger relief, Summer Food Programs positively impact children’s development by providing an opportunity for the community, schools and engaged partners to come together to offer nutritious meals, local foods, educational activities and encourage healthy lifestyles.
